Texas Instruments PCM3120-Q1 Software-Controlled Audio ADC is a Burr-Brown™ high-performance, audio analog-to-digital converter (ADC) that supplies simultaneous sampling of up to two analog channels or four digital channels for the pulse density modulation (PDM) microphone input.
The TI PCM3120-Q1 Software-Controlled Audio ADC implements line and microphone inputs for single-ended and differential input configurations. The ADC integrates programmable channel gain, digital volume control, a programmable microphone bias voltage, a phase-locked loop (PLL), a programmable high-pass filter (HPF), biquad filters, and low-latency filter modes while permitting sample rates up to 768kHz.
The ADC supports time-division multiplexing (TDM), I2S, or left-justified (LJ) audio formats and can be controlled with the I2C interface. These integrated high-performance features, combined with the ability to be powered from a single supply of 3.3V or 1.8V, make the device an ideal choice for space-constrained audio systems in far-field microphone recording applications.
The PCM3120-Q1 is specified from -40°C to +125°C and is housed in a 20-pin WQFN package.
